The Lord of the Rings and the other stories created by Tolkien are his homage to thousands of years of human knowledge, language and creativity, to which he devoted his entire academic life.

The book lives and breathes because it's OUR story. From the first tales told by our ancestors, to the everyday stories and songs shared by friends and neighbors.

No matter what culture, people will recognize the archtypes portrayed in Tolkein's works. Frodo and the Fellowship are not only heros, they are All Heros, throughout time.
